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United StatesThe room is tired, but functional. Everything works but the carpet is worn and coming up in places, paint is scraping off, etc. It's an older place. But the main issues we had were the noise, the lack of ability to clean dishes and the curtains did not make the room fully dark--the windows do not shut out noise and the air condition turning on and off all night is also very noisy. There is no dish soap or anything to clean with. We would have appreciated being able to use the dishes more. There are curtains but they are more fancy then functional so they don't fully cover the windows which meant the room had more light than we like. There are no working USB plugs or upgraded plugs for electronics. The alarm clock had and old docking station but that wasn't very useful.
We appreciated how close to the main museums and the park the hotel was. Our premier suite was spacious with an extra 1/2 bath, a keurig, fridge and microwave. We stayed a week and the keurig was refilled daily. There was also a set of glass dishware that we used almost every day and it was replaced, clean each day. Our daughter stayed on the pull out couch and said it was comfortable. There are two separate air conditioners which made it easy to adjust temps in the bedroom and the living room.

United KingdomOne tiny issue: the room keycards are very easily de-activated (by contact with phone, other cards etc.) and each time this happened we were advised to throw the old cards away - would be great if the hotel can find a more environmentally-friendly solution as this felt unnecessarily wasteful.
We absolutely loved our stay - our deluxe room with two queen beds was definitely big enough for our family of 4 (2 adults and 2 teens - all tall!). The beds and room was spacious, and we made good use of the gym, with water refill station to save us buying water. The location in midtown is great, and we did the majority of sightseeing by foot from there. Particular thanks to the really friendly concierge (apologies we didn't get his name, but he had white hair and a really friendly welcome) who made it feel like home every time we returned to the hotel. If you're looking for good value breakfast in the area would recommend Scoop Bagels (7 E 53rd St), which set us up for the day. If wanting a traditional old diner (more expensive) would recommend Murray Hill Diner, which gave us 80s film vibes!
